  • Godot Card Game Framework

    A framework which comes with prepared scenes and classes to kickstart your card game, as well as a powerful scripting engine to use to provide full rules enforcement.

  • Godot [0] is super intuitive, so I recommend it wholeheartedly. And then you ought to look at the Godot Card Game Framework [1], which I've also used for a uni project.

    The author has a couple of examples (check their Github repo), which you can play online [2][3]. Also, join the Discord (check the repo for a link). The community is very friendly and helpful (just be sure to learn Godot first, though).
